引言 随着信息技术的飞速发展,区块链作为一种新兴的技术,正逐渐走进人们的视野。它以其去中心化、不可篡改和...
区块链交易系统是一种基于区块链技术构建的交易网络,它为数字资产(如加密货币、智能合约等)的交易提供了一个安全、透明和去中心化的平台。在这个交易系统中,所有交易记录都被存储在一个公共的分布式账本中,任何参与者都可以实时查看,确保信息的透明性和不可篡改性。
这种系统的一个核心特点是它的去中心化特性,意味着没有单一的控制者或中介机构负责管理交易。传统的金融系统通常依赖于中央银行或其他金融机构来监督和处理交易,而区块链则通过网络中的所有节点共同维护整个系统的安全性和稳定性。
## 2. 区块链应用交易系统的工作原理区块链交易系统的工作原理可以分为以下几个步骤:
### 2.1 用户发起交易用户通过钱包软件发起一笔交易,将指定数量的数字资产发送给另一个用户。交易请求包括发送方的数字签名和接收方的公钥,确保交易的合法性。
### 2.2 交易验证一旦交易被发起,它就会被广播到整个网络。矿工节点会接收到这一交易请求,并对其进行验证,确保交易的有效性。这包括检查发送方是否拥有足够的资产和交易的合法性。
### 2.3 交易打包经过验证的交易会被打包成一个区块。每个区块包含多个交易记录、一个时间戳以及前一个区块的哈希值,以确保区块链的连续性和不可篡改性。
### 2.4 区块链更新新的区块被添加到区块链中,所有节点更新他们的账本,以反映最新的交易。在整个过程中,所有交易的记录和历史都被永久保存,确保系统的透明性和安全性。
## 3. 区块链交易系统的优势相较于传统的交易系统,区块链交易系统具有许多优势:
### 3.1 安全性每笔交易都经过多重验证,区块链技术的加密特性使得数据难以篡改。这种不可变性使参与者能够放心进行交易,降低了欺诈风险。
### 3.2 透明性所有交易记录对所有用户都是可见的,这种实时透明性有助于增强系统的信任度,特别是在金融交易的场景中。
### 3.3 去中心化消除了对特定中介的依赖,降低了相关费用,同时也减少了单点故障的风险,增加了系统的抗攻击性。
### 3.4 降低成本传统交易过程中的手续费用往往较高,而采用区块链技术则可以通过去中心化的方式减少这些费用,使交易更加高效和成本友好。
### 3.5 快速交易区块链交易系统允许24/7的操作,用户可以随时发起和完成交易,与传统银行系统相比大大缩短了交易时间。
## 4. 区块链应用交易系统的实际案例分析越来越多的行业开始采用区块链交易系统,这里我们将探讨几个成功的应用案例:
### 4.1 金融领域:比特币与以太坊比特币和以太坊是区块链技术的代表性数字货币。比特币为人们提供了一种替代传统货币的方法,而以太坊则扩展了智能合约的概念,允许开发者在其区块链上创建去中心化应用(DApps)。
### 4.2 供应链管理区块链在供应链管理中的应用能够提供实时追踪与透明信息,减少欺诈和错误。例如,某些食品企业使用区块链技术追踪从农场到超市的每一步,保证消费者可以获取到安全、健康的食品信息。
### 4.3 医疗健康在医疗健康领域,区块链交易系统为患者提供了一个安全的平台来存储和管理他们的健康记录,只有得到授权的医生才能访问患者的信息。这不仅增加了隐私保护,还便于及时提供急救服务。
### 4.4 版权保护与数字内容管理区块链还被应用于版权保护中,通过智能合约确保创作者能获得合理的报酬,避免侵权问题。例如,音乐和艺术产业中的一些平台开始使用区块链来管理数字内容的权利。
## 5. 未来展望与挑战区块链应用交易系统虽然前景广阔,但也面临着一些挑战:
### 5.1 监管与法律问题不同国家和地区对区块链技术的监管政策尚在完善之中,这可能影响相关企业的运营。法律的不确定性可能会导致市场的不稳定性。
### 5.2 技术标准化区块链技术的标准化缺乏统一,市场上存在多种不同的区块链平台和协议,这可能导致互操作性问题,限制了应用范围。
### 5.3 能源消耗基于工作量证明(PoW)的区块链网络如比特币,其能源消耗问题日趋严重,因此需要探索更加环保的共识机制,如权益证明(PoS)。
### 5.4 用户教育虽然越来越多的人开始了解区块链技术,但仍有大量用户对其运作原理和使用方式不够了解。因此,需要加强用户教育,使更多人能够安全和高效地使用区块链交易系统。
## 6. 相关问题探讨 接下来,我们将探讨关于区块链应用交易系统的五个相关问题,这些问题将加深对这一主题的理解。 ###安全性是区块链交易系统的首要关注点之一。区块链技术通过以下几种方式确保安全性:
1. **加密技术**:区块链使用了先进的加密算法,如SHA-256,对所有交易数据进行加密。这使得任何试图篡改链上数据的行为都是物理上不可行的。 2. **分布式账本**:区块链通过其分布式性质,保证所有数据的副本存在于网络中的多个节点。即使某些节点遭到攻击或故障,其他节点仍然可以保持系统的完整性。 3. **共识机制**:区块链依靠诸如工作量证明(PoW)和权益证明(PoS)等共识机制,确保网络上的所有节点对交易的合法性达成一致。这减少了欺诈活动的可能性。 4. **智能合约**:智能合约是自动执行的代码,确保一旦预定条件满足,相关交易将自动被执行。智能合约被部署在区块链上,保证其执行过程不受人为操作的影响。 5. **多重签名钱包**:为了提高安全性,用户可以使用多重签名钱包,这要求多个私钥进行验证交易。这降低了单个密钥被盗用的风险。 通过上述技术手段,区块链交易系统展现出了一种前所未有的安全性,这为用户提供了极大的信心。 ###